Why would you hunt a cougar? Do people eat the meat or something? I don't get it.
@Whiskr
@Whiskr 8 жыл бұрын
For sport, trophy, and to control overpopulation for the most part. On occasion one might also be attacking livestock, or otherwise be deemed a public or ecological danger and may be hunted. Thankfully they have the safest possible rating on the official conservation scales, despite a currently decreasing population. When it comes to eating, you could (and a rare few do), but apex predators usually make for tough, dry meat and typically have trichinae, as well as potential bio-magnification related toxins and other parasites/diseases. Those who do would mostly do so for the novelty or because they only hunt what they'll eat.
